Activism Education

The Activersity curriculum is based on modules covering activism philosophy, history of activism, group decision-making, fund-raising, and more. Beyond lectures, students have access to articles, videos, and podcasts. Writing assignments encourage students to explore beyond the presented material.

Our Residency program entails fellowships which include room-and-board in the Schwaz10 building, are available for students who wish to develop practical skills by working on a real project under the aegis of the Activersity.

Pizza Lab Is A Community Space

Pizza Lab is a vegan pizzeria entirely run by volunteers. The restaurant is a registered commercial entity owned by the Activersity NGO. Profits fund the Activersity as well as occasional grants to sustainability projects in the neighborhood.

We Invented the Task Auction

For any living community, how chores are distributed/performed is a source of friction. How do we know that everyone is doing a fair share of the work? Who gets assigned which tasks? Who decides what is fair?

The “Task Auction” and the “Wahlbörse” were conceived as a single system to answer these questions while providing maximum flexibility and transparency.

We Went to Help in Ukraine – The Birth of the Activersity

Night view of a line of cars at the Ukraine-Poland border in March 2022

In spring 2022, we helped at the Polish-Ukrainian border, taking goods to Lviv and refugees back to Poland. With donations, we were able to fund the trip and buy more goods. It turned out to be the birth of the Activersity Project.
